From bb31956a96c583cc5386c0e4cd595c13471569b3 Mon Sep 17 00:00:00 2001 From: Varun Agrawal Date: Wed, 4 Jan 2023 02:52:33 -0500 Subject: [PATCH] enable previously failing test, now works!! --- gtsam/hybrid/tests/testHybridEstimation.cpp |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) diff --git a/gtsam/hybrid/tests/testHybridEstimation.cpp b/gtsam/hybrid/tests/testHybridEstimation.cpp index a45c5b92c..4a53a3141 100644 --- a/gtsam/hybrid/tests/testHybridEstimation.cpp +++ b/gtsam/hybrid/tests/testHybridEstimation.cpp @@ -114,7 +114,7 @@ TEST(HybridEstimation, Full) { /****************************************************************************/ // Test approximate inference with an additional pruning step. -TEST_DISABLED(HybridEstimation, Incremental) { +TEST(HybridEstimation, Incremental) { size_t K = 15; std::vector measurements = {0, 1, 2, 2, 2, 2, 3, 4, 5, 6, 6, 7, 8, 9, 9, 9, 10, 11, 11, 11, 11}; @@ -151,9 +151,6 @@ TEST_DISABLED(HybridEstimation, Incremental) { graph.resize(0); } - /*TODO(Varun) Gives degenerate result due to probability underflow. - Need to normalize probabilities. - */ HybridValues delta = smoother.hybridBayesNet().optimize(); Values result = initial.retract(delta.continuous());